Aye Khudaa Song Description
This song "Aye Khuda" is the second song from the Ginny Weds Sunny 2 movie, featuring Avinash Tiwary and Medha Shankr. The song is composed and written by Usman Khan, and sung by Altamash Faridi, with the music label being Sony Music India.
The lyrics of the song are very emotional and heartfelt. They tell the story of a person who is heartbroken in love and is asking questions to their khuda (God). The lyrics say, "Hasna Toone Sikhaya, Rona Bhi Toone Sikhaya" (You taught me how to laugh, you also taught me how to cry), meaning the lover taught them both happiness and pain, but now the same person is rejecting them. The singer asks, "Ai Khuda, Jaayein To Jaayein Kahan?" (Oh God, where do I go?), which makes you feel like a lost soul who cannot find any direction.
In the further verses, the pain and loneliness become even clearer. Lines like "Tu Nahi Jaanti, Tu Hi To Paas Thi" (You don't know, you were the one who was with me) show that the other person was their entire world, and now they are left all alone. The entire song feels like an emotional journey, where love, rejection, and existential questions come together. The music and vocals deepen this pain even further.
